#6f6d98 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6f6d98 is composed of 43.5% red, 42.7%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27% cyan, 28.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 242.8 degrees, a saturation of 17.3% and a lightness of 51.2%. #6f6d98 color hex could be obtained by blending #dedaff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#6f6d98
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030204 is the darkest color, while #f7f7f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6f6d98
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#808085 is the less saturated color, while #180df8 is the most saturated one.
